Nóz D'Alecrin formed in Braga in the early 1990s. Their 2001 album 'Comprador de Alegrias' gave them one of their best-known songs, which shares the album's title. Other tracks like 'Motor' and 'Ô Pequena' also became staples for the group.
The band's lineup has included Francisco Naia on lead vocals and guitar, Pedro Seromenho on vocals and guitar, João Braga on vocals and mandolin, and José Salgueiro on vocals and accordion. They've worked with other Portuguese artists like José Afonso, Fausto, and Marisa.
Their music draws from Portuguese folk traditions, but they've sometimes faced criticism from purists for their approach. They've released albums including 'Cantigas do Povo' in 1995 and 'Margem' in 1998.
